Rishabh Pant's Road to Redemption: Overcoming Challenges and Competition (2026)

Rishabh Pant's journey in international cricket has been a rollercoaster, and former India cricketer Syed Kirmani has some strong words of advice for the young wicketkeeper-batter. Kirmani believes that Pant's flamboyance, physical fitness, and temperament need to be addressed if he wants to reclaim his place in all formats of the game. Pant, who was once touted as a natural all-format player, has seen his opportunities limited to Tests in the past two years. This is despite his impressive performances in the Indian Premier League (IPL), where he plays as a T20 specialist. Kirmani's analysis is insightful, as he points out that Pant's temperament is 'very vulnerable, turbulent'. The former wicketkeeper-batter, who played 88 Tests and 49 ODIs between 1976 and 1986, emphasizes the importance of physical fitness and consistency. He argues that Pant must show better consistency than other wicketkeepers to earn his place back. This raises a deeper question: how do we define consistency in cricket? The accident that seriously injured Pant in December 2022 has undoubtedly impacted his career. It provided an opportunity for other wicketkeepers to shine and establish themselves. Now, Pant faces fierce competition from the likes of KL Rahul, Dhruv Jurel, Ishan Kishan, and Sanju Samson. This competition is a testament to the depth of talent in Indian cricket, but it also adds to the pressure on Pant to perform. The current breed of wicketkeepers and batters, Kirmani notes, is more focused on their batting prowess, which may be a result of the changing dynamics of the game.
